I decided that for my first look I would go with a simple geometric mani using Sensational So Chic, Mostly Mint, and Something Blue along with What’s Up Nails wide chevron and single chevron vinyls. I couldn’t be happier with how this turned out especially since this was basically my first time using vinyls with gel polish!

Sensationail Geometric Macro.jpg

I have to say that I am extremely impressed with the quality of Sensational’s gel colors. They were all so, so easy to use. Each polish was opaque in two easy coats and that’s with layering them over each other!

Word of caution: make sure you use a good gel base and top coat or else it might start to peel off in a couple of days. I first tried Orly FX gel and base coat and was not having much luck but switched over to Gelish brand and I had no issues.
